Interesting KHL rule could be adopted by the NHL and Gary Bettman
The NHL has been criticized for its overtime possession game, in which players sometimes skate the puck back into their zone to kill time or reset line changes.
This strategy has led to calls for a rule change, and the KHL is taking action to address this issue.
The KHL is testing a new rule in its Junior Hockey League (MHL) that penalizes teams for excessive puck possession in the defensive zone during overtime. Under this rule, if a team skates the puck out of the offensive zone and into its own, it receives a warning for the first violation. A second violation results in a minor penalty. The aim is to prevent teams from stalling and to encourage more offensive play.
If successful, this rule could revolutionize overtime strategies in North America. The NHL may consider similar changes if the KHL's implementation proves effective.
